Coloring pages, including those featuring Raphael Ninja Turtle, have numerous benefits for kids. They can help improve fine motor skills, hand-eye coordination, and concentration. Coloring pages can also be a great way to reduce stress and anxiety, promoting relaxation and calmness. Additionally, coloring pages can foster creativity and self-expression, allowing kids to explore their imagination and bring their ideas to life.
